General Purpose

The Staff Physical Therapist Assistant assists the Staff Therapist with patient related activities and direct patient care.

Essential Duties

• Treat patients as directed by Physical Therapist.

• Record daily treatment notes and weekly progress notes per PT Board.

• Assist in maintaining department.

• Participate in Patient Care and Rehabilitation Conferences, as needed.

• Assist with cleaning and maintenance of treatment area.

• Treat patients per the physician treatment plan.

• Assist nursing department with training of Restorative Aides.

• Communicate with supervisor and other health team members regarding patient progress, problem and plans.

• Participate in in-services training program for other staff in the facility.

• Record treatment changes per policy and procedures.

• Instruct patient's families or nursing staff in maintenance program and caregiver training in preparation for discharge from therapy services.

• Report any problems with department equipment so that it is maintained in good working order.

• Ability to relate positively, effectively, and appropriately with patients/residents, families, staff and professional colleagues.
